Modern Create a media wall with an electric fireplace to raise your flatscreen TV and give the room something that will impress. First, determine if you&#39;re going for an inset or wall-mounted design. Inset fireplaces, also referred to as holes in the wall or inbuilt fireplaces are recessed into a wall. They offer an elegant look and uniform appearance. They are also slightly farther from the wall than a freestanding gas or electric fireplace and feature an in-front heater that directs the warmth into the living area. However they require a deeper cavity than other types of installations and may require some significant renovation work to an existing stud wall, or the construction of a new chimney breast. These fireplaces are a great choice for homes built in the past or homeowners who wish to create a cozy country-style living area. By contrast, a wall-hung fire, such as the Celsi Electriflame VR Volare 1100 is mounted directly onto the wall, just like a TV, and can be installed with no major construction work. They&#39;re usually easier to set up than an inset model which can be a time-consuming process and requires some DIY skills. Wall-hung fires can have a more modern aesthetic and, based on the design, could provide a stunning visual impact. You can also personalize the space with an electric or media wall as well as a fire. For instance, you can choose a remote control with programmable functions and an &#39;only flame setting to ensure that you don&#39;t waste energy heating up the room when it&#39;s not in use. Some models come with LED lights that change colour and log effect finishes that mimic the appearance of different kinds of wood. If you&#39;re planning to incorporate an electric fire that&#39;s mounted to the wall in your media wall, think about the size of the fireplace. It&#39;s crucial that the fireplace does not overwhelm the TV, or make it appear too small. To achieve the ideal balance, your electric fireplace should be around 1/3 the width of your TV. A fireplace built into the wall can bring warmth and comfort to a space. Inset electric fireplaces designed for media walls are typically installed in a wooden frame, or stud walls. This creates a seamless appearance. The walls are then clad in plasterboard or any other cladding. The electrical installation work takes place. Plug sockets are relocated or new ones are made to be used with your TV, Electric Fire and any additional items you may have included in your design e.g. speakers, shelving etc. Depending on the model, you might want to consider smart integration or app control. You can utilize your smartphone to control the fireplace from afar. It also offers scheduling options so you can start the fireplace prior to arriving home or shut it off at night. Make precise measurements of the wall that you would like to put an electric fire in. This will ensure you select an appropriate product that is specifically designed to fit your wall. You can then use masking tape mark out the shape of your wall media and then compare this with the specifications of the model you&#39;re considering. Once you&#39;ve decided on the model that is suitable for you, it is time to begin the installation. The first step is to build an elongated stud wall with timber framing with lengths of wood for horizontal supports, leaving a gap to accommodate your TV recess that has an inset electric fireplace. Then, the frame is clad with plasterboard or any other type f cladding and the gap is filled in. You can then fit your TV and finish off the room by decorating and painting it.
